Transaction 104c2d524f5724f25a005f3a2177507ed824e547e53e275022cad1c2783a84d5

1 Input
2 Outputs
  • 104c2d524f5724f25a005f3a2177507ed824e547e53e275022cad1c2783a84d5:0
  • value  9344208
    address  3FYXqNSSKnuAoqwprT5z6QgdiswG9qXpug
  • 104c2d524f5724f25a005f3a2177507ed824e547e53e275022cad1c2783a84d5:1
  • value  580583438
    address  1DMAyYMAesyPWHQ4hKT3oannvdBVWasxrN